According to your profile, the rate is $35 per night. If you don't think it is a good rate, then you should take a look at what other sitters in your area charge and go a little lower initially to gain clients.

I noticed that your puppy rate is the same as your regular boarding rate, but you have a higher puppy rate for daycare. Some sitters charge more for regular boarding of puppies as they are more work.

You also have another option, which is to discount for a longer stay. You alone determine what (how many days) qualifies as an "extended" stay. HOWEVER, I would never discount for a puppy in any circumstance. In fact, I don't even accept puppies.

How you charge is up to you. While you need to be competitive with other sitters in your area, you also need to look at puppy care and if it is priced appropriately.
